Missouri Gov Mike Parson reflects on tumult of 2020 at start of first full term

Gov. Mike Parson promised to work on behalf of all Missourians after being sworn in for his first full term Jan. 11 though he didn’t mention in the speech specific items he hopes to achieve in the coming four years. Parson, a Republican who ascended to the state’s highest office in June 2018 following the resignation of Gov. Eric Greitens, was sworn in by Circuit Judge Sarah Castle of Kansas City. Castle, who uses a wheelchair because she lost the use of her legs to a rare disease at age 11, was appointed by Parson to her current post in October.

Catholic bishop prays God will bless, guide Missouri s newly elected officials

Jan 15, 2021 catholic news service Bishop W. Shawn McKnight of Jefferson City, Mo., prays at the end of the inauguration ceremony for members of Missouri s executive branch outside the state Capitol in Jefferson City Jan. 11, 2021. The event also marked the beginning of a yearlong celebration for Missouri s bicentennial of statehood. (Credit: CNS photo/Dan Bernskoetter via The Catholic Missourian.) Bishop W. Shawn McKnight of Jefferson City prayed Jan. 11 that God would bless and guide the newly sworn officials of Missouri s executive branch to lead not just with the power of their office but also with the moral authority founded on personal integrity and character.

Inauguration For Governor Mike Parson Set For Today

Posted By: Sarah Myers January 11, 2021 @ 6:43 am Local News, News Governor Mike Parson will be sworn in as Missouri’s 57th Governor this morning. Today marks Missouri’s Bicentennial Inauguration, as the Show-Me State celebrates 200 years of statehood later this year. The ceremony will begin at 11 a.m. in Jefferson City on the South Lawn of the Capitol building. https://fb.watch/2X PtzDfOG/ To prepare for the upcoming inauguration, a prayer service was held for Gov. Parson in Bolivar over the weekend. Over 100 people gathered at Southwest Baptist University on Saturday to pray with the Parson family. During the inauguration, other elected officials will also take their oath, such as State Treasurer Scott Fitzpatrick, Secretary of State Jay Ashcroft, Attorney General Eric Schmitt, and Lieutenant Governor Mike Kehoe.
